Panera hosts fundraising night for autism

Bring your family and friends to Panera on Patteson Drive Thursday (April 26) from 4 p.m. to 8 p.m. to support the Intensive Autism Service Delivery Clinic at the Center for Excellence in Disabilities. The iASD Clinic provides evidence-based treatment to young West Virginia children while serving as a training site for WVU students to receive supervised training on Applied Behavior Analysis required to become certified therapists.

The iASD Clinic is a collaboration between the Center for Excellence in Disabilities, the School of Medicine Pediatrics Department and the Psychology Department.
